Acting IGP summons report on six cases including the assasination of Lasantha Wickramathunge

by Staff Writer 18-08-2019 | 9:36 PM
COLOMBO (News 1st):- Acting IGP C.D.Wickremeratne has ordered the CID to provide him with reports regarding six major incidents including the assassination of Senior Journalist Lasantha Wickremethunga. This is in response to a letter sent by the Attorney General on the 15th of this month regarding five major investigations being carried out by the CID. The Attorney General had inquired regarding the following incidents. 1) The assassination of Lasantha Wickrematunga 2) The death of Wasim Thajudeen 3) The abduction of Keith Noyahr 4) Murder of 17 relief workers in Muttur 5) Abduction and forced disappearance of 11 youth The AG instructed the acting IGP to conclude the investigations into the five incidents without delay and submit the investigation files to the Attorney General's Department. Police media spokesperson SP Ruwan Gunasekara said that the IGP requested for a report on these five cases and the abduction and disappearance of journalist Ekneligoda from the Senior Deputy Inspector General of Police in-charge of the Criminal Investigations Department. He further said that the CID has been informed to compile reports on all of these 11 matters separately in all of these six cases and hand it over on or before August 23rd.
